org.drools.planner.examples.nurserostering.domain.solver
Class EmployeeWorkSequence
java.lang.Object
org.drools.planner.examples.nurserostering.domain.solver.EmployeeWorkSequence
- All Implemented Interfaces:
- Serializable, Comparable<EmployeeWorkSequence>
public class EmployeeWorkSequence
- extends Object
- implements Comparable<EmployeeWorkSequence>, Serializable
- See Also:
- Serialized Form
EmployeeWorkSequence
public EmployeeWorkSequence(Employee employee,
int firstDayIndex,
int lastDayIndex)
getEmployee
public Employee getEmployee()
setEmployee
public void setEmployee(Employee employee)
getFirstDayIndex
public int getFirstDayIndex()
setFirstDayIndex
public void setFirstDayIndex(int firstDayIndex)
getLastDayIndex
public int getLastDayIndex()
setLastDayIndex
public void setLastDayIndex(int lastDayIndex)
equals
public boolean equals(Object o)
- Overrides:
equals
in class Object
hashCode
public int hashCode()
- Overrides:
hashCode
in class Object
compareTo
public int compareTo(EmployeeWorkSequence other)
- Specified by:
compareTo
in interface Comparable<EmployeeWorkSequence>
toString
public String toString()
- Overrides:
toString
in class Object
getDayLength
public int getDayLength()
Copyright © 2001-2013 JBoss by Red Hat. All Rights Reserved.